Report: Bills To Hire Marrone As New Head Coach
Published at(BUFFALO) — Syracuse’s Doug Marrone has agreed to become the new head coach of the Buffalo Bills, according to ESPN.
The 48-year-old Marrone has spent the past four seasons as head coach of the Orange, compiling a record of 25-25, including 11-17 in Big East conference play. During his tenure, he led Syracuse to a pair of bowl victories in the Pinstripe Bowl.
Marrone will replace the fired Chan Gailey, who went 16-32 in three seasons as Buffalo’s head coach.
